On mar., 2010-06-15 at 11:45 +0200, Yusuf iskenderoglu wrote:
> I wanted to note that of my two systems running debian unstable (daily
> upgrades) on i386 and amd64, only the 32-bit version of evolution
> crashes when showing emails with text/calendar attachments.
> 
> The trace that is being generated shows, that itip_format() is causing
> the problem.
> 
> Disabling the "ITIP Formatter" plugin on the 32-bit system results in
> stability, however with reduced functionality regarding event
> notification mails (the interface is no longer displayed, the mail is
> interpreted as text).
> 
Please report that upstream and provide a backtrace.
